智能文档生成新范式:基于AI的PPT自动化创作实践

作者:Nicky2026.01.28 15:06浏览量:0

简介:本文深入探讨智能文档生成工具的核心技术架构与实现路径,通过解析某主流智能创作平台的运作机制,展示如何利用自然语言处理与模板引擎技术,在30秒内完成从主题输入到专业PPT生成的完整流程。重点分析智能内容生成、多模态素材匹配、动态排版引擎三大技术模块的协同机制,并提供二次编辑接口的技术实现方案。

一、智能文档生成的技术演进与核心价值
传统PPT制作流程面临三大痛点:内容构思耗时(平均4.2小时/份)、视觉设计门槛高(需掌握专业设计工具)、版本迭代效率低(修改需全流程重做)。智能文档生成技术的出现,通过自动化内容生成与智能排版引擎,将制作效率提升80%以上。

某主流智能创作平台采用”NLP理解+模板引擎+视觉生成”的三层架构:

  1. 自然语言处理层:基于Transformer架构的文本理解模型,支持对输入主题的语义解析与关键要素提取
  2. 内容生成引擎:结合知识图谱与行业模板库,自动生成包含逻辑框架、数据支撑、案例分析的完整内容大纲
  3. 视觉渲染系统:通过多模态对齐算法,将文本内容与矢量图标、数据图表、背景模板进行智能匹配

二、智能创作系统的技术实现路径
(一)内容生成模块的技术实现

  1. 主题解析阶段:采用BERT-base模型进行关键词提取,通过依存句法分析识别核心概念与修饰关系。例如输入”2024年新能源汽车市场分析”,系统可解析出时间维度(2024年)、行业领域(新能源汽车)、分析类型(市场分析)三个核心要素。

  2. 内容框架构建:基于行业知识图谱的路径推理算法,自动生成包含市场现状、竞争格局、技术趋势、政策影响、发展建议的标准分析框架。测试数据显示,该算法在12个行业领域的框架生成准确率达到92.3%。

  3. 细节内容填充:集成Web爬虫与API接口的数据获取模块,可自动抓取权威统计数据(如乘联会销量数据)、行业报告核心观点、企业公开财报信息。通过模板变量替换技术,将结构化数据填充至预设内容模块。

(二)视觉呈现系统的技术突破

  1. 智能排版引擎:采用约束满足算法(CSP)实现动态布局,支持对文字区块、图表容器、图片占位符的自动排列。通过定义12种基础布局模板与200+样式变量,可生成符合黄金分割比例的版式方案。
  1. # 伪代码示例:布局约束求解
  2. def solve_layout_constraints(elements, canvas_size):
  3. constraints = [
  4. (element1, 'width', '>', 50),
  5. (element2, 'top', '==', element1.bottom + 20),
  6. (element3, 'center_x', '==', canvas_size.width/2)
  7. ]
  8. solver = CSPSolver()
  9. return solver.solve(constraints)
  1. 多模态素材匹配:构建包含50万+矢量图标的素材库与3000+专业模板库,通过CLIP模型实现文本-图像的跨模态检索。当检测到”市场份额”关键词时,系统可自动匹配饼图、柱状图、堆叠面积图三种可视化方案。

  2. 动态渲染优化:采用WebGL加速的Canvas渲染技术,支持对25页文档的实时预览与交互编辑。通过资源懒加载策略,将首屏渲染时间控制在800ms以内,滚动流畅度达到60fps。

三、二次编辑接口的技术设计
为满足专业用户的个性化需求,系统提供完整的二次编辑API:

  1. 内容编辑接口:支持对文本框的富文本操作(字体/颜色/对齐方式)、段落层级调整、要点增删
  2. 素材替换接口:提供图标库搜索(支持SVG/PNG格式)、图表数据绑定(支持CSV/JSON导入)、图片版权过滤
  3. 布局定制接口:开放页面边距、分栏比例、元素间距等20+样式参数,支持通过CSS-like语法进行自定义
  1. // 示例:通过API修改图表数据
  2. document.getElementById('chart1').updateData({
  3. type: 'bar',
  4. data: {
  5. labels: ['Q1','Q2','Q3'],
  6. datasets: [{
  7. label: '销售额',
  8. data: [120,190,150]
  9. }]
  10. }
  11. });

四、技术实现中的关键挑战与解决方案

  1. 长文本生成的一致性控制:采用分段生成+全局校验的混合策略,在生成每个章节后进行主题漂移检测,通过BERTScore算法计算语义相似度,确保全文逻辑连贯性。

  2. 多语言支持的实现:构建包含中英日等8种语言的平行语料库,在NLP处理层集成FastText语言检测模块,自动切换对应语言的模板库与素材资源。

  3. 版权合规性保障:与权威素材供应商建立API直连,所有商用素材均附带CC0授权证书。通过图像指纹识别技术,对用户上传图片进行版权溯源检查。

五、典型应用场景与技术优势
在金融路演场景中,系统可自动生成包含行业数据、竞品分析、财务模型的25页专业报告,制作时间从传统6小时缩短至18分钟。教育领域应用显示,教师使用智能生成功能后,课件准备效率提升75%,且学生满意度提高22%。

技术评估数据显示,该方案在内容准确率(89.7%)、视觉专业度(86.4分/100)、操作便捷性(4.7/5.0)等核心指标上均优于行业平均水平。特别在复杂逻辑内容的结构化呈现方面,通过知识图谱增强技术,实现了对传统模板工具的代际超越。

结语:智能文档生成技术正在重塑知识工作者的创作范式。通过将NLP、计算机视觉、优化算法等前沿技术深度融合,某主流平台已构建起覆盖内容生成、视觉设计、交互编辑的全流程解决方案。随着大模型技术的持续演进,未来的智能创作系统将具备更强的上下文理解能力与创意生成能力,为数字化转型提供更强大的生产力工具。